Path: utzoo!utgpu!news-server.csri.toronto.edu!cs.utexas.edu!sdd.hp.com!think.com!snorkelwacker.mit.edu!stanford.edu!unix!Teknowledge.COM!uw-beaver!cornell!calvin.ee.cornell.edu!richard From: richard@calvin.ee.cornell.edu (Richard Brittain - VOS hacker) Newsgroups: comp.os.msdos.apps Subject: Freemacs + mouse problem Message-ID: <1991Apr27.015948.8086@calvin.ee.cornell.edu> Date: 27 Apr 91 01:59:48 GMT Organization: Cornell Space Plasma Physics Lines: 16 I have just discovered that Freemacs apparently modifies the cursor when it detects a mouse driver present - I just got a mouse and now the cursor disappears if I run freemacs with the mouse driver loaded. Everything else seems to work correctly and the mouse-specific stuff seems to work. I'm using freemacs 1.6a with an EGA display. Does anyone know if there is a work around for this. On shelling out to dos, there is still no cursor and examining the bios data area, the cursor start/end scan lines have been set to 32/0 Thanks, -- Richard Brittain, School of Elect.
